Important Materials

Tick treatments use different active ingredients. Some common ones include:

  • Pyrethrins/Pyrethroids: These are often derived from chrysanthemum flowers or made in labs. They work fast to kill ticks.
  • Neem Oil: This is a natural ingredient that can repel and kill ticks.
  • Essential Oils: Certain oils like peppermint or rosemary can also help deter ticks.

Always check the label for the specific active ingredients and their percentages.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Tick Lawn Treatment

Q1: What is tick lawn treatment?

A: Tick lawn treatment is a product you apply to your yard to kill and repel ticks. It helps make your lawn safer for people and pets.

Q2: How often should I treat my lawn for ticks?

A: This depends on the product and how bad the tick problem is. Some treatments last for a few weeks, while others last for a couple of months. Check the product label for specific recommendations.

Q3: Is tick lawn treatment safe for my pets?

A: Many tick treatments are safe for pets when used as directed. However, it’s crucial to read the product label carefully. Some products may require you to keep pets off the lawn for a certain period after application.

Q4: Can I use tick lawn treatment around my vegetable garden?

A: Some treatments are safe for use around gardens, while others are not. It’s best to choose products labeled as safe for edible plants or to avoid treating areas where you grow food.

Q5: What is the best time of year to treat my lawn for ticks?

A: You should treat your lawn in the spring when ticks become active, and again in the late summer or early fall. Ticks are most active in warmer months.

Q6: How do I apply tick lawn treatment?

A: Application methods vary. Some products are ready-to-spray, while others are concentrates that you mix with water. You might use a hose-end sprayer or a backpack sprayer. Always read and follow the instructions on the product label.

Q7: Will one treatment get rid of all the ticks?

A: One treatment can significantly reduce the tick population. However, it might not eliminate every single tick. Repeated applications might be necessary for complete control, especially in heavily infested areas.

Q8: What are the signs of a tick infestation in my yard?

A: You might see ticks on your pets, on yourself after being outside, or notice them in areas with tall grass and leaf litter. Increased tick bites are a clear sign.

Q9: Are natural tick treatments as effective as chemical ones?

A: Natural treatments can be effective for repelling ticks and may kill some. However, chemical treatments often offer faster and longer-lasting tick control for severe infestations.

Q10: Where should I avoid spraying tick treatment?

A: Avoid spraying directly on water sources like ponds or streams. Also, be careful around bird feeders and areas where beneficial insects like bees might be present.
